Developers
Build on the SMB operations schema.
adaptlive publishes a canonical schema for the things every small business cares about — customers, people, companies, locations, work records, money records, conversations. Connect your tool once; every other tool in the catalog reads and writes the same shape.
Published canonical schema
Every connected system writes to the same Customer / Person / Company / Location / WorkRecord / MoneyRecord / Conversation graph. Field-level edit history. No untyped JSON.
Browse the schemav1 REST API + webhooks
Bearer API keys minted from Settings. Per-entity routes for SMS, calls, voicemails, work-records, drafts, facts, signals. HMAC-signed outbound webhooks on every canonical change.
Read the API referenceZapier + adapter SDK
Ship a Zap in minutes — 14 triggers, 5 actions, 2 searches. Or build a certified adapter against the TypeScript pull / push / reconcile contract.
View the adapter SDKThe canonical graph
One shape, every connected tool.
Customer is the spine — a household, business, or matter that everything else hangs off of. People and Companies attach to Customers via membership roles. Locations, ContactMethods, WorkRecords, MoneyRecords, and Conversations all reference the same Customer. Field-level edit history is built in: every value records which adapter set it, when, and what the previous value was.
v1 REST API · shipped
Read and write the graph over HTTPS.
Bearer API keys minted from Settings. Idempotent writes viaIdempotency-Keyheader. HMAC-SHA256 signed outbound webhooks on every canonical event. OpenAPI spec at /api/v1/openapi.json.
- POST
/api/v1/smsSend an outbound SMS from one of your AdaptLive numbers. - GET
/api/v1/work-records?kind=JOBList jobs, appointments, matters, deliveries, or cases — filtered by kind. - GET
/api/v1/voicemailsVoicemails with transcript + recording URL. - GET
/api/v1/callsCall sessions with transcript segments, drafts, and captured facts. - POST
/api/v1/webhooksSubscribe to canonical events. HMAC-SHA256 signed deliveries. - GET
/api/v1/factsCaptured facts on calls, drafts, and work records — keyed by canonical fact definition.
Zapier · shipped
14 triggers. 5 actions. 2 searches.
The AdaptLive Zapier app is live. Wire calls, voicemails, SMS, drafts, signals, and per-kind work-record events (job / appointment / matter / delivery / case) into the 6,000+ apps Zapier already speaks. REST-hook subscriptions under the hood — sub-second delivery, not poll-and-pray.
Sample triggers
call.endedFull transcript + drafts + factssms.receivedThreaded to a Person if resolvedvoicemail.receivedWith recording URL + transcriptwork_record.created (kind=JOB)Field-service jobswork_record.created (kind=APPOINTMENT)Medical / dental / salonwork_record.created (kind=MATTER)Legal practicesignal.firedComplaints, upsell, churn riskdraft.approvedPost-call draft ready to sync
The dev portal
Sandbox first. Production when you're ready.
Every approved partner lands in /portal with a pre-provisioned sandbox org, realistic seeded fixtures, and a webhook deliveries inspector. Build, break, replay — without ever touching a live customer.
Sandbox org, pre-seeded
Every approved partner gets a sibling SANDBOX organization auto-provisioned and pre-loaded with realistic fixtures — Maria Hernandez voicemail, a kitchen-faucet leak work record, a linked Person + Customer + SMS thread. Test against shapes that look like the real world, not empty tables.
API keys + webhook subscriptions
Mint Bearer keys, subscribe to canonical events, and inspect HMAC-signed delivery history with replay. Scoped to your sandbox until you're ready for production.
Live deliveries inspector
Every webhook delivery — request, response, signature, retry state — visible in the portal. Debug without grepping logs.
Clerk invite on approval
Apply via /work-with-us. On approval you get an emailed Clerk invite, your sandbox is provisioned in the background, and you land in /portal with everything wired up.
Three integration tiers.
Pick the level of fidelity your customer needs. All three write to the same canonical schema — they only differ in how the data gets there.
Native adapter
Tier 1adaptlive maintains the integration. Full adapter contract — pull, push, reconcile, webhooks. Real-time, two-way, audited.
Best for high-fidelity, two-way systems customers rely on every day.
Partner-built adapter
Tier 2Software partner builds against the published contract; adaptlive certifies and marketplace-lists. Same fidelity as native.
Best for software partners that want a certified customer path.
Connector
Tier 3No bespoke adapter required — bridge through the v1 REST API, the Zapier app, outbound webhooks, or a warehouse drop. Lower fidelity, universal reach.
Best for lightweight data movement, imports, and workflow triggers.
Partner program
Three ways to partner.
One application form, three tracks. Pick the one that matches how you want to work with us.
Software
SOFTWAREYou sell software to small businesses and want a certified adapter against adaptlive's schema. Marketplace listing, co-marketing, revenue share.
Channel
CHANNELYou implement, train, and support small businesses. Referral fees, deal registration, and a partner-of-record relationship on every customer you bring.
Affiliate
AFFILIATEYou have an audience. One-time $100 bounty per qualified signup — last-touch attribution, 60-day window. No quotas, no contracts.
Get a sandbox today.
Apply to the partner program. We review applications within two business days. Approval emails you a Clerk invite, auto- provisions a seeded sandbox org, and drops you in the portal with API keys ready to go.
